Ad Fraud Is Not an Anomaly – It’s a Logical Response to How the System Defines Success
Ad fraud persists because programmatic systems reward the wrong evidence of success. The industry treats technical delivery, viewability, and server activity as proxies for human attention, creating a category error that Goodhart’s Law makes increasingly profitable to exploit. Ad stacking and low-quality inventory flourish because they satisfy those measurable rules without producing meaningful communication. Reducing the waste requires attentive CPM, supply path optimization, and incrementality testing that measure attention and behavioral lift rather than compliant telemetry.

Programmatic advertising promised automated buying at a speed and scale no human team could manage by hand. It offered precision targeting, global reach, and the apparent certainty of mathematical accountability.
The machinery worked. The definition of success did not.
Forensic audits estimate that $26.8 billion in global programmatic value disappears into the supply chain each year before producing anything useful. Much of that money isn’t being stolen in the familiar sense. It is being spent correctly according to rules that never required the advertising to work.
The Perfectly Obedient Algorithm
Consider a standard Fortune 500 consumer campaign. The buying system finds inexpensive inventory that clears the required viewability threshold and begins moving budget toward it.
The dashboard reports millions of impressions. They are technically viewable and remarkably cheap. The campaign is on pace.
Market share doesn’t move. Sales lift remains flat.
The dashboard is accurately reporting the events it was built to record. The algorithm is executing its objective with precision. The software is doing exactly what it was told to do.
The failure sits inside the definition of a successful transaction. The system was told that a viewable impression counted as a win, so it acquired viewable impressions at scale.
Follow one dollar through the programmatic supply chain. Transaction fees remove twenty-nine cents. Invalid traffic, including bots, fraudulent activity, and junk inventory, consumes another twenty-seven cents. Only forty-four cents ultimately qualifies as working media that a person might encounter.
A supply chain that loses more than half its value before reaching a possible audience has moved beyond ordinary inefficiency. Better negotiation and a tighter campaign brief can’t repair a structure built to leak.
A Server Log Is Not a Memory

Philosophy has a name for assigning a property to something that cannot possess it: a category error. Asking what color Tuesday is would be a category error. So would asking how much a symphony weighs. The question applies the logic of one category to something belonging to another.
Digital advertising commits a similar error billions of times a day. An ad server recording a delivered impression confirms a successful technical exchange between a server and a device. A packet of data arrived. A pixel rendered. The system logged the event.
None of those facts proves that a person noticed the advertisement, processed its message, remembered the brand, or changed behavior. The industry has spent two decades pricing a plumbing event as though it were a psychological one.
Picture both realities at the same moment. On one side, the server performs flawlessly and records a success. On the other, the person’s eyes are somewhere else and their attention is fully occupied.
The pixel rendered. Communication never occurred.
A server log is not a memory. Building a multibillion-dollar market on the assumption that those two things are equivalent makes waste inevitable.
Viewable Isn’t the Same as Seen
The viewability standard began as a reasonable solution to a real problem. Advertisements were loading at the bottom of pages that users never reached, yet advertisers were still being charged for the impressions.
The Media Rating Council established a clear threshold. For a standard display ad to count as viewable, at least half its pixels must remain within the visible screen for one continuous second.
The rule was geometric, measurable, and auditable. It still couldn’t establish attention.
An advertisement can satisfy the viewability requirement while the reader’s eyes remain fixed on the article above it. The brain filters peripheral clutter so it can concentrate on the material that matters. Banner blindness makes this especially severe for anything shaped like an advertisement.
The ad appears on the screen. The mind removes it from the experience.
Across the open web, a large share of technically viewable inventory receives no meaningful visual attention. The standard can satisfy an auditor while failing to capture the human event advertisers believed they were buying.
Goodhart’s Law explains what follows: once a measure becomes a target, it loses its reliability as a measure. Viewability began as a proxy for the opportunity to see an advertisement. Once money and optimization systems treated it as the goal itself, the market began producing viewability rather than attention.
The Target Becomes the Product
A market organized around viewability doesn’t require fraudsters to create genuine human attention. They only need to generate signals that satisfy the technical test.
Half the pixels. One continuous second.
A script can clear that threshold without a person anywhere near the screen. Demand-side platforms evaluate available inventory according to the objectives they receive. When cheap placements consistently produce high viewability scores, the platforms direct more money toward them. Expensive, human-produced publishing environments lose budget to cheaper inventory that performs better against the selected proxy.
The algorithm reads those placements as efficient because the measurement system defined them that way. Fraud becomes the rational business built to serve the demand.
The industry’s rules created a financial reward for anyone capable of simulating delivery. Suppliers responded by producing more simulated delivery.
Fifty Layers Deep

Ad stacking shows how literal this incentive can become. A publisher places dozens of separate advertisements within the exact same screen coordinates. A person can see only the top layer. The verification system records every layer underneath because each ad technically loaded inside the visible portion of the page.
Fifty ads can occupy the same pixels. All fifty may pass the viewability test. All fifty can be billed.
A bidding algorithm sees a domain producing a high volume of inexpensive, viewable impressions and allocates more money to it. The verification software authenticates the geometry while remaining unable to authenticate the presence of a human audience.
The result resembles what economists call a lemon market. Buyers struggle to distinguish legitimate inventory from low-quality inventory before purchasing it. Inferior supply spreads because it is cheaper to produce and appears similar according to the available signals.
Honest publishers then compete against inventory manufactured to pass the test at almost no cost. The damage extends beyond one wasted campaign. Cheap, invisible supply weakens the value of every legitimate impression sold beside it.
What Happened When JPMorgan Cut 99 Percent
JPMorgan Chase put the system through a practical test. The company reduced the number of websites carrying its programmatic advertising from roughly 400,000 to about 5,000. Its available domain reach fell by approximately 99 percent.
A reduction that severe should have damaged performance if the eliminated inventory had been creating meaningful value. Customer acquisition costs didn’t increase. New-account performance remained stable.
The enormous volume of removed inventory had produced little measurable business effect. Procter & Gamble and Uber conducted their own efforts to reduce questionable programmatic activity and uncovered the same broad pattern: industrial-scale waste could sit behind compliant campaign metrics without contributing corresponding business value.
These companies didn’t discover that every removed impression was fraudulent. They revealed something more important. The reported scale of delivery had been largely disconnected from the outcomes the advertising was supposed to produce. Hundreds of millions of technically flawless impressions were worth little from the moment they were purchased.
Paying for Attention Instead of Attendance

Return to the factory floor. A stricter time clock won’t make the loading dock move. Management has to begin paying for what gets built.
The same correction applies to advertising measurement. Viewable cost per mille and raw click-through rates measure observable technical events. They remain useful within narrow limits, but they cannot carry the full burden of proving effectiveness.
Attention measurement attempts to move the unit of value closer to the human experience. Biometric eye tracking and predictive models can estimate visual fixation and cognitive engagement. Attentive CPM then prices media according to verified seconds of attention rather than delivery alone.
The change also requires cleaner buying routes. Supply path optimization audits the intermediaries between advertiser and publisher, removes redundant steps, and favors routes that provide transparency and genuine value. It reduces the opportunities for fees and low-quality inventory to accumulate inside an opaque chain.
Incrementality testing provides a different standard of proof. Randomized control groups help determine whether advertising caused additional behavior, separating genuine lift from purchases or actions that would have happened anyway.
Together, these methods ask better questions. Did a person pay attention? Did the advertising produce behavior beyond the expected baseline? Did the money reach inventory capable of creating value? Those questions move measurement away from attendance records and toward finished output.
Measuring the Right Thing
A perfect dashboard proves that a campaign satisfied the conditions encoded within the dashboard. Its meaning depends entirely on whether those conditions represent the outcome the business actually values.
Viewability measures geometry. Banner blindness separates geometry from perception. Goodhart’s Law turns the proxy into a target. Ad stacking produces the target cheaply. A lemon market then allows low-quality supply to spread through a system whose buyers cannot reliably distinguish delivery from value.
JPMorgan, Procter & Gamble, and Uber tested that system by removing enormous amounts of apparent reach without suffering an equivalent loss in performance. The evidence points toward a different standard. Advertising should be judged through verified attention, transparent supply paths, and causal business lift.
You get exactly the outcome your measurement system was built to reward, nothing more and nothing better.
The dashboard was never lying. That is what makes the problem difficult to correct with a memo or a new fraud-detection vendor.
Every fraudulent impression, every stacked advertisement, and every dollar that vanished into the supply chain was the predictable output of a system following its own definition of success. Frequently Asked Questions
Why does ad fraud persist in programmatic advertising
Ad fraud persists because programmatic systems often pay for technical proof of delivery rather than verified human attention. Fraudulent inventory can satisfy viewability rules, produce compliant telemetry, and appear efficient to buying algorithms. The system rewards simulated delivery even when no person meaningfully sees or responds to the advertisement.
What is programmatic advertising?
Programmatic advertising is the automated, algorithm-driven buying and selling of digital advertising inventory. Demand-side platforms evaluate available placements and purchase impressions according to objectives such as price and viewability. The process operates at enormous speed and scale, but its effectiveness depends entirely on whether the chosen metrics represent genuine business value.
What is viewability, and why is it not the same as attention?
Viewability is a technical standard that generally counts an advertisement when at least half its pixels remain inside the visible screen for one continuous second. It measures geometric placement. It can’t establish whether someone looked at the ad, processed its message, remembered it, or changed behavior because of the exposure.
What is banner blindness?
Banner blindness is the tendency to ignore page elements that resemble advertising, even when those elements appear clearly within the visible screen. A display ad can meet the formal viewability standard while receiving no meaningful attention. Technical visibility and human perception remain separate events.
How does Goodhart’s Law explain digital ad fraud?
Goodhart’s Law states that when a measure becomes a target, it stops functioning as a reliable measure. Once advertisers began paying for viewability, publishers and fraud operations gained a financial reason to maximize viewable events rather than human attention. Optimizing the proxy gradually replaced achieving the original goal.
What are ad stacking and a lemon market?
Ad stacking places multiple advertising units in the same screen coordinates, allowing verification software to record many viewable impressions even though a person can see only the top layer. When buyers can’t distinguish this inventory from legitimate placements, low-quality supply spreads and creates a lemon market that damages pricing and trust.
Are viewability metrics useless for advertisers?
Viewability can confirm that an advertisement had an opportunity to appear on screen, which makes it useful as a limited diagnostic measure. Problems begin when advertisers treat it as proof of attention or effectiveness. It should be supported by transparent supply paths, verified attention data, and evidence of incremental business outcomes.
How can advertisers reduce programmatic waste and fraud?
Advertisers can audit and simplify buying routes through supply path optimization, measure verified attention through attentive CPM, and use incrementality testing to determine whether exposure caused additional behavior. The strategic shift is simple: stop rewarding impressions merely because they loaded and begin proving that advertising changed something that matters.
